Solution:
Sexual dimorphism is noticed in Tylenchulus sp.
Sexual dimorphism is the condition where the sexes of the same animal and/or plant species exhibit different morphological characteristics, particularly characteristics not directly involved in reproduction.
Tylenchulus semipenetrans is a dimorphic species that exhibit sexual dimorphism (male and female individuals) at both the juvenile and adult stage.
